The Dallas Plan Commission voted unanimously on Thursday in favor of rezoning the Shoreline City Church property on Garland Road, making way for a four-story apartment complex adjacent to the Lochwood neighborhood. By Carol Bell-WaltonSpecial Contributor Thanks to the dedicated efforts of East Dallas-area advocates, the White Rock Lake Task Force is celebrating its 25th anniversary.  The Task Force is comprised of stalwart representatives from 17 neighborhood associations, numerous nonprofit organizations that serve the park, recreational users’ groups, and various environmental groups.
